Abstract
We study the covariant quantization of the Green-Schwarz (GS) superstrings proposed recently by Berkovits. In particular, we reformulate the Berkovits approach in a way that clarifies its relation with the GS approach and allows to derive in a straightforward way its extension to curved spacetime background. We explain the procedure working explicitly in the case of the heterotic string.
